Mikhail Fedorovich Larionov (1881-1964)

Seven plates, from L'Art Décoratif Thèatral Moderne
five pochoirs, a lithograph and linocut, of which six are in colours, 1919, on wove paper, comprising Le Grillon, 'Un Paon'-costume mécanique, Personnage de 'La Marche funèbre sur la Mort de la Tante à héritage', Le Cygne, Décoration pour 'Baba-Yaga' Kikimora and 'Martin-Pecheur'- costume mécanique, with the title-page, text, justification and original cover, from the edition of 400, published by Edition La Cible, Paris, with margins, time-staining darkening at the sheet edges, three with a centre fold crease as published, occasional soft-creasing and short tears, otherwise generally in good condition
S. 500 x 325mm. (and smaller) (7)
